Transaction e8767c9b3600df1e0d0225fdd6800501832b3edae3424a26ac95bc384a441d1d
1 Input
1 Output
-
e8767c9b3600df1e0d0225fdd6800501832b3edae3424a26ac95bc384a441d1d:0
- value
- 775220
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f0540668d6a239d55fdd13e3762bf9b93aa8836
- address
- bc1q3uz5qe5ddg3e640a6ylrwc4lnwf64zpkd73yux